|Hollywood is mourning the loss of Robert Redford, who peacefully passed away at the age of 89 surrounded by his loved ones at his Sundance home in Utah. While the world remembers him as a legendary actor, director, and activist, his family is reflecting on the man they simply called dad and grandpa.
In the days following his death, Redford’s grandchildren shared rare and deeply personal family photos, offering fans a glimpse into the private side of a man whose public life spanned decades of cinematic history. The touching images show Redford enjoying quiet moments with his family, spending time outdoors, and capturing memories far away from the Hollywood spotlight.
One of his grandsons shared heartfelt snapshots that span Redford’s lifetime from childhood memories to more recent gatherings writing that while the world saw him as larger than life, to them he was simply family. Another grandchild posted images alongside her late father and grandfather, honoring the connection between three generations.
The emotional tributes highlight Redford’s greatest role that of a family man. Beyond his iconic performances in films like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kid and The Way We Were, Redford leaves behind a legacy of love, resilience, and deep devotion to those closest to him.
Redford is survived by his wife, Sibylle Szaggars, his daughters Shauna and Amy, and seven grandchildren who continue to carry his spirit forward. For them, and for countless fans around the world, his memory will forever remain a guiding light.
